A Brief Synopsis of Latinx Heritage Month

By pjco811 | September 14, 2022

Latinx Heritage Month or Hispanic Heritage Month (government designation) is celebrated between September 15 – October 15 to recognize and honor the impactful contributions of Latinx Americans on United States’ history.  This month helps celebrate the many heritages and cultures that encompass Latin America and learn about its breadth and diversity. Filing a Complaint & Other Government Resources

If you feel you have been subjected to unlawful discrimination or harassment and are not satisfied with your company's response, or do not have a trusted human resources pathway, you may file a complaint and find more resources below. We have listed both national and state specific government sites geared toward your civil rights and disability protections.
